Ingredients
For the Oreo Crust:
- 24 Oreo cookies (crushed into fine crumbs)
- ¼ cup unsalted butter, melted
For the Cheesecake Filling
- 16 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 ½ cups heavy whipping cream
- 1 teaspoon peppermint extract
- 1 ½ cups mint chocolate chips (or chopped mint chocolate)
- 6-8 Oreo cookies (chopped into chunks, optional for texture)
For the Topping (Optional)
- Whipped cream
- Extra mint chocolate chips or chopped Oreos
Directions
- Step No.1: Prepare the Oreo crust
In a medium-sized bowl, combine the crushed Oreo cookies with melted butter. Mix until the crumbs are evenly coated.
- Press the mixture into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an or pie dish to form an even crust. Refrigerate while you prepare the filling.
- Step No.2: Make the cheesecake filling
In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th and creamy.
- Gradually add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ract, continuing to beat until well combined. Add the peppermint extract and mix until incorporated.
- Step No.3: Whip the cream
In a separate bowl, beat the heavy whipping cream with an electric mixer on high speed until stiff peaks form.
-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ture until fully incorporated.
- Step No.4: Add the chocolate
Melt the mint chocolate chips in the microwave or on the stovetop, stirring every 20 seconds until smooth.
- Let the chocolate cool slightly before folding it into the cheesecake mixture. If desired, stir in chopped Oreos for added texture.
- Step No.5: Assemble the cheesecake
Pour the cheesecake filling over the chilled Oreo crust, spreading it evenly with a spatula.
- Smooth the top and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ight to allow the cheesecake to set.
- Step No.6: Add the topping
Before serving, top with whipped cream and extra mint chocolate chips or chopped Oreos for an added touch of flavor and decoration.
- Step No.7: Serve and enjoy
Slice the cheesecake and serve cold. Enjoy the refreshing mint flavor and the crunchy Oreo crust in each bite!

Tips for Success
- Use Softened Cream Cheese: Make sure your cream cheese is softened before mixing to avoid lumps and ensure a smooth filling.
- Chill the Cheesecake Well: Allow the cheesecake to set in the fridge for at least 4 hours or overnight. This will give the cheesecake its perfect texture.
- Add More Mint Flavor: If you want a stronger mint flavor, add a bit more peppermint extract or use mint chocolate chips instead of regular chocolate chips.
- Whipped Cream Consistency: Be sure to whip the cream to stiff peaks before folding it into the cream cheese mixture. This ensures a light and airy texture.

Serving and Storage
Serving
Serve this No-Bake Oreo Mint Cheesecake chilled, topped with whipped cream and extra mint chocolate chips or crushed Oreos for a decorative and delicious finish.
Storage
Store any leftover cheesecake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The cheesecake can also be frozen for up to 1 month. Thaw it in the fridge before serving.

NO-BAKE OREO MINT CHEESECAKE
Ingredients
For the crust:
- 24 Oreo cookies crushed
- 5 tablespoon unsalted butter melted
For the cheesecake filling:
- 16 oz cream cheese softened
- 1 cup heavy whipping cream
- ½ cup powdered s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- ½ teaspoon peppermint extract
- ½ cup mini chocolate chips optional
- 10-12 mint Oreo cookies chopped (for mixing into filling)
For the topping:
- ¼ cup mini chocolate chips optional
- Crushed Oreo cookies or mint Oreo pieces for garnish
Instructions
- In a medium bowl, combine crushed Oreo cookies and melted butter. Mix until the crumbs are evenly coated with butter.
- Press the mixture into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an to form an even crust. Chill in the refrigerator for 10-15 minutes while preparing the filling.
- In a large b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with powdered sugar and vanilla extract until smooth and creamy.
- In a separate bowl, whip the heavy cream until stiff peaks form, then gently fold it into the cream cheese mixture.
- Add the peppermint extract and mix until well combined.
- Fold in the chopped mint Oreos and mini chocolate chips (if using).
- Pour the cheesecake filling into the chilled Oreo crust and smooth the top with a spatula.
- Refrigerate the cheesecake for at least 4 hours, or until fully set (overnight for best results).
- Before serving, garnish with extra mini chocolate chips and crushed mint Oreos on top.
- Slice, serve, and enjoy!
Notes
- For a more intense mint flavor, increase the amount of peppermint extract to taste.
- You can use regular Oreos instead of mint Oreos if you prefer a less minty taste.
- For a lighter version, swap heavy cream with whipped topping or Greek yogurt, though the texture will differ.
- This cheesecake can be made up to 2 days ahead of time, making it perfect for parties and gatherings.
- If you don’t have a springform pan, a 9-inch pie pan can also be used.
- You can freeze this cheesecake for up to 1 month; just cover tightly and thaw in the refrigerator before serving.
- For extra texture, add crushed Oreos or mint chocolate chips to the cheesecake filling.
- This dessert can also be served as mini cheesecakes in individual cups or jars for a fun presentation.
